Get Up Close with Birds in the Hand
One of the highlights of the morning is the live bird ringing demonstration. This involves carefully catching wild birds, placing small identification rings on their legs, and releasing them back into the wild. It’s a unique chance to see birds close up and learn about their behavior, migration, and conservation.

You might see species such as:
Robins
Blue tits
Wrens
Our experienced bird ringers will explain the process and answer questions, making it a fascinating experience for all ages.
Discover Moths and Night-Time Minibeasts
Although moths are mostly active at night, you can learn about these fascinating creatures during the day. We’ll introduce you to the different types of moths and bugs that visit the reserve after dark. You’ll find out how moths contribute to the ecosystem and why they are important pollinators.

This part of the event includes:
Identifying common moth species
Understanding moth life cycles
Spotting other nocturnal minibeasts hiding in the reserve
